Recently UPIKE hosted “It’s On Us!” week, and one of the most talked about events was when a student chose to carry a mattress with her on campus to spread more awareness. Josie Stewart, senior, carried a mattress with quotes written on it that were discouraging to victims. Her goal was to show the campus some of the statements these victims often hear.
“Sometimes, after people in class move seats away from me, I try to think if it’d be better if I said nothing. Then, a girl comes up to me and tells me her story and thanks me for what I’m doing and for helping her get closure, and I wouldn’t want to change that for the world,” said Stewart.
Stewart also didn’t think that the stunt would receive as much coverage as it did.
“I didn’t really think it’d catch on as quick as it did. I mean, day one I did two interviews and by day two, I was on TV…”
Stewart hopes that her efforts help combat sexual assault, and she wants all those who have been personally affected by it to know that they are not alone.
